A typical Sioux Falls electrical project runs $500-$7,400 depending on scope. $78-$190/hr, SD State Electrical Commission license required. 200A panel upgrades and EV charger installations are the most common large projects.
Sioux Falls Building Services permits average 4-6 weeks for typical residential work Electrical permits run $80-$350 plus inspection. Sioux Falls requires South Dakota State Electrical Commission license; verify at local jurisdiction (no statewide SD GC license).
Sioux Falls metro hosts roughly 2,500 contractors registered with local SD jurisdictions. Sioux Falls labor runs 9% below national average (affordable market). EV charger installations run $1,400-$2,700 in Sioux Falls; combining EV install with a needed panel upgrade saves significant cost vs separate projects.
Generator and transfer switch installations are growing project categories given winter grid reliability concerns. Whole-house standby generators run $7,500-$14,000 installed. Portable-with-interlock setups run $2,000-$3,500. Sioux Falls electrical costs range widely: outlet/switch install $200-$550; 200A panel upgrade $2,500-$5,500; Level 2 EV charger $1,400-$2,700; generator with transfer switch $7,500-$14,000; whole-house rewire $9,000-$17,000. $78-$190/hr, SD State Electrical Commission license required.
Likely yes if you have an older 100A panel and are adding EV charging, heat pump HVAC, electric water heater, or major addition. Panel upgrades take 1-2 days and cost $2,500-$5,500.
Sioux Falls Level 2 EV charger installations run $1,400-$2,700 for typical garage installs. Federal Section 30C credit covers 30% of EV charger installation up to $1,000.
